Hungary’s budget posts EUR 419 m surplus in Jan
Hungary’s cash-flow budget, excluding local councils, posted a surplus of 151.3 billion forints (EUR 419 m) at the end of January, the Finance Ministry said on Tuesday, citing preliminary data.
The central budget had a surplus of 84.4 billion forints. Separate state funds were 34.3 billion in the black and the social insurance funds had a 32.6 billion surplus.
The full-year cash-flow budget deficit target is 3,152.7 billion forints.
